Beautiful elegant ceremonial dress from the British Army. This particular jacket from the British army would've been worn by a Warrant Officer on ceremonial duties, or for parade events. No. 1 dress is the highest level of dress uniform most soldiers will wear, and is earned after a good few years in the army, with each part of the uniform being tailor made.
For features, it is quite a simple jacket, made from 100% wool. There's 4 pockets in total, 2 flap and 2 buttonable flap pockets, arranged in the typical "safari" style, with 2 on the hips and 2 on the chest. The collar is mandarin style, being closed with 2 hook & eyes. On the shoulders you'll find shoulder epaulettes, usually designed to secure ribbons and other sashes during ceremonial events. For the colour, it is a very dark navy blue, bordering on black.
